Deciphering the role of PGRMC2 in the human endometrium during the menstrual cycle and in vitro decidualization using an in vitro approach

GSE251843 Homo sapiens Expression profiling by high throughput sequencing 8 samples Submitted 2024/12/15 Platform GPL26180
Summary
The endometrial response to progesterone is mediated by the classical and non-classical progesterone receptors. We previously demonstrated that PGRMC1 is critical for endometrial function, embryo implantation, and future placentation, however, the role(s) of PGRMC2, which is structurally similar to PGRMC1, have not been studied in the human endometrium.
